We are seeking a passionate and enthusiastic Learning Support Assistant (LSA) to join our dynamic team. As an LSA, you will play a vital role in supporting our students' educational and personal development. You will work closely with teachers, therapists, and other support staff to create a positive and engaging learning environment tailored to the unique needs of each student.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ide one-on-one and group support to students with SEN, including those with autism, ADHD, and other learning difficulties.
  • Assist in the implementation of Individual Education Plans (IEPs) and adapt learning materials to meet students' needs.
  • Support classroom activities and help maintain an inclusive, positive classroom atmosphere.
  • Encourage and promote social and emotional development through positive reinforcement and engagement.
  • Assist with personal care needs, where required, ensuring the safety and dignity of students.
  • Collaborate with teachers, therapists, and parents to monitor and report on student progress.
  • Participate in training and professional development opportunities to enhance your skills and knowledge in SEN education.

Requirements:

  • Previous experience working with children with SEN in a school or similar setting is highly desirable.
  • A patient, compassionate, and empathetic approach to working with children.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to work effectively as part of a team.
  • A commitment to promoting inclusion and equality in education.
  • Relevant qualifications or training in SEN support (e.g., CACHE Level 2/3, NVQ, or equivalent) is advantageous.
  • A valid Enhanced DBS check (or willingness to obtain one).
